Atletico Madrid coach Simeone defends hooking Diego Costa, Griezmann for Girona draw

Atletico Madrid coach Diego Simeone defended his players after their 1-1 draw with Girona.

Antoine Griezmann's first half opener was cancelled out after a Jose Gimenez mistake allowed Portu to equalise just 17 minutes from the end.

"According to you we are very bad, however according to me we are doing fine," he explained in his post-match press conference

"The match was well played, we controlled a dangerous opponent but it's clear a goal always gives a team a chance to draw.

"Sometimes these games go in your favour, as happened against Eibar, yet today in a rare moment it went against us."

Both Diego Costa and Griezmann were withdrawn by the former River Plate coach, much to the bemusement of home supporters; however Simeone moved to justify both calls.

"Costa had discomfort in his hamstring in the first half, I preferred to remove him to ensure he didn't get hurt," he intimated.

"Griezmann understood that the match was controlled and that the presence of Koke would improve us in midfield. By the way, he is one of the best football players in Spanish football.

"People will always be angry because they wanted us to win."
